Omnipollo is a Swedish microbrewery known for its innovative style of beers and vivid, imaginative beer can design.

Omnipollo is a "gypsy brewery", meaning that the brewery designs and markets their beers, but the beers are physically brewed at other breweries.

History[]

Omnipollo was founded in Stockholm by brewer Henok Fentie and artist Karl Grandin in 2010. A common friend of Fentie's and Grandin's saw that the pair had similar visions and introduced them to each other. They first discussed art more than beer but soon moved to creating their first beer product, a Belgian-style beer called Leon.[1]
